What Causes Solar Photovoltaic Panel Explosions?
While rare, solar panel explosions often make headlines due to their dramatic nature. Let's break down the primary culprits:
- Electrical arc faults: Responsible for 43% of solar-related fires (NREL 2023 data)
- Improper installation creating hot spots
- Degraded insulation materials
- Lightning strikes during thunderstorms
"A single damaged cell can generate enough heat to melt adjacent components – it's like a domino effect of thermal runaway," explains Dr. Emily Zhou, renewable energy safety researcher at Stanford University.

Prevention Strategies That Actually Work
Here's what leading installers like EK SOLAR recommend:
- Quarterly infrared thermography scans
- Arc-fault circuit interrupters (AFCIs)
- Robust wildlife deterrent systems
Pro Tip:
Always check your inverter's error logs – they're like a black box recorder for your solar system's health.

When Maintenance Matters Most
Your solar system's needs change over time:
| System Age | Critical Checks |
|---|---|
| 0-2 years | Connection integrity |
| 3-5 years | Insulation resistance |
| 6+ years | Full component stress tests |
